CVE-2022-0968
Last modified
CVE-2022-0968 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 5.5/10 on the CVSS scale. The microweber application allows large characters to insert in the input field "fist & last name" which can allow attackers to cause a Denial of Service (DoS) via a crafted HTTP request. in microweber/microweber in GitHub repository microweber/microweber prior to 1.2.12.. EPSS estimates a 3.73%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
